This presentation is a thorough overview of being a Hosta collector based on years of experience. Come and learn the mistakes I have made to get this experience. Topics include identification, purchase considerations, where to plant, how to feed and handling pests and diseases that want to put a damper on your hobby.
After retiring in 2014, Fred accidently took up gardening and is now totally out of control. The 7.5 acre wooded property called Anderson Estate sits on top of a hill overlooking the Smoky Mountains so has become an expert in gardening on slopes. About four acres of the property are under garden and the hardiness zone is 7a. Fred is the president of the East TN Hosta Society and has a collection of over 500 different Hostas. He became a master gardener in 2016 and sits on the boards of the three horticultural organizations. Apart from Hostas he is an avid plant collector of Azaleas, Rhododendrons, Camellias, Holly’s, Conifers, Tropicals and native plants. Fred welcomes garden clubs and the public with visitations during the year.
